Uma busca curiosa foi pelos fontes do DOS. Embora até onde eu saiba a Microsoft não publicou os fontes do MS-DOS, quem estiver curioso sobre como fazer um sistema compatível tem pelo menos duas opções:
- FreeDOS: um projeto de software livre, é usado pelo excelente DosBox para simular um PC antigo e permitir rodar programas antigos (particularmente jogos).
- DR-DOS: tem uma história longa e curiosa. A Digital Research era a lider dos sistemas operacionais para os computadores profissionais de 8 bits com o CP/M-80. No lançamento do PC, a IBM deu preferência ao MS-DOS. Após anos tentando sem sucesso vender o CP/M-86, a Digital Research aproveitou um momento em que a Microsoft estava ocupada com os projetos do Windows e do OS/2 para lançar o DR-DOS. Altamente compatível com o MS-DOS, o DR-DOS 5 vinha com utilitários adicionais e utilizava os recursos de gerenciamento de memória do 386. A resposta da Microsoft foi o MS-DOS 5 e uma série de ações que posteriormente foram julgadas anti-competitivas (alguns documentos a respeitos podem ser vistos aqui). A Novell adquiriu a Digital Research e lançou um bundle do DR-DOS 6 com um pacote de rede local peer-to-peer (durante toda a vida do MS-DOS, a comunicação via rede local sempre foi um item a parte e que era explorado por empresas como a Novell e a Lantastic). Apesar de todo este esforço, o DR-DOS nunca conseguiu decolar e entre várias mudanças de dono acabou tendo os fontes liberados para o uso não comercial.
Nenhum comentário:
Postar um comentário